2022 Hajj: Saudi Arabia Allocates 43,000 Hajj Seats To Nigeria

The Executive secretary of Kano state pilgrims welfare Board Alhaji Mohammad Abba Danbatta says 43,000 Hajj seats have been allocated to Nigeria for this year’s Hajj operations.

Mohammad Abba Danbatta stated this while updating Journalists on the 2022 Hajj operations.

He said the National Hajj Commission has informed all the state pilgrims board of the recent development.

Mohammad Abba Danbatta explained that the slot was against the 95,000 allocations approved for the country in the previous years.

With the 43,000 allocations, NAHCON is expected to distribute the seats among the 36 states and Federal Capital Territory, FCT.”

The executive secretary maintained that the National Hajj Commission was yet to announce this year’s hajj fares, stressing that soon the final hajj fares will be Announced.

” from all indications, there will be little increase on the Hajj fares compared to that of last year, Saudi Arabia has introduced the value-added tax in all monetary transactions, as such this increase will replicate on all hajj activities ”

Mohammad Abba Danbatta added that the kano state Pilgrim’s welfare board will not relent in ensuring that the welfare of pilgrims was well attended to, aimed at having a successful Hajj operations.
